  1. What is virtue? • Passion • Faculty • State of Character

  2. Spectrum Virtue: the mean between extremes Deficiency Mean Excess Fear ---Confidence Coward Courage Rash

  3. “Moderation in all things.” As Mom says:

  4. eudaimoniaeudaimonia An activity of the soul in conformity with perfect virtue extended over a lifetime supplemented by sufficient external goods. "Happiness"

Your Example Cause Definition Example Aristotle’s Four Causes Material Cause “that out of which a thing comes to be, and which persists” Elements: earth, air, water, fire, or… “Wood is what the table is made out of.” Formal Cause “the statement of essence” “the account of what-it-is-to-be” Shape, figure, blueprint, type… “Having four legs and a flat top is what it is to be a table.” Efficient Cause “the primary source of change, generation, or movement” The man who gives advice, the father (of a child)… “A carpenter is what produces a table.” Final Cause “the end or goal, that for the sake of which a thing is done” Health (is the cause of exercise)… telos “Writing upon is what a table is for.”
